How can I speak Italian fluently?

I think the answer by Colin de Wit is very complete. I would recommend making taking a course to learn grammar and pronunciation first. Then try to find Italian speaking friends to speak with, pen pals to communciate with especially on Skype, etc. Listen to music, watch tv programs and movies in Italian and read newspapers, magazines and books even in digital versions.  The best way of course is to spend time in Italy, either working or studying in a good language school. I learned Italian after I had studied French in college so I was advantaged because of the similarities. But I was lucky because I lived in North Beach in San Francisco for 6 years and heard Italian spoken in the shops by Italians living and working there. Then I came to live in Italy. So now I speak it very fluently. But since I don't have much chance to use my French I have been losing the skills I developed during college.
